针对高效视频编码(HEVC)帧内预测模式的信息隐藏算法,提出了一种隐写检测算法。基于帧内预测模式的信息隐藏算法,通过修改原始视频的帧内预测模式完成隐秘信息的嵌入。实验表明,这种操作会导致部分帧内预测单元(PU)的大小(4×4、8×8、16×16、32×32和64×64)发生改变。对隐写视频进行相同参数的重压缩后发现,不同大小的PU在数量上有向原始视频恢复的倾向,而原始视频重压缩后PU数量变化很小。定义了视频重压缩前后各尺寸PU数量及占有比例的变化率,并以此以作为特征,结合支持向量机(SVM)分类器进行视频信息隐藏检测。实验结果表明,本文算法简单、高效,而且对不同分辨率和不同量化参数的视频均有良好的检测效果。
In this paper, for detecting secret information through modifying HEVC intra-prediction mode, a steganalysis algorithm is proposed. In the implementation process of these steganographic algorithms, a large number of intra-prediction modes are modified. This operation leads to changes in the size of prediction Unit (PU) ,including the sizes of 4×4,8×8,16×16,32×32 and 64×64. We re-compress the original video and the video with secret information using the same configuration parameters. It's found that the changes of PU amount for the stego video after re-compression are larger than those for original video without steganography. In the experiment, we firstly calculate the amount of PU different sizes with before and after re-compression. Then the change rate is defined about the amount of various PU and the proportion of various PU. The change rate before and after the re-compression are taken as effective features and sent to support vector machine (SVM) classifier to finish the detection of hiding information. Experimental results demonstrate that the algorithm is simple and efficient. Moreover, it is suitable for videos with different resolutions and different quantization parameters.